Q4 USF Factor to Increase to Record 27.1%, Says Gregg

The Q4 USF contribution factor will increase from 26.5% to 27.1%, “the highest contribution factor in the history of the USF," Universal Consulting owner Billy Jack Gregg emailed stakeholders Tuesday. The numbers are based on Universal Service Administrative Co. projections of revenue at $10.428 billion, up $209 million sequentially. “Total USF revenues for 2020 will be $42.6 billion -- the lowest in the history of the USF,” said Gregg. “This represents a decline of $33.6 billion, or 44%, since revenues peaked in 2008.” Total projected USF demand for 2020 will be $345 million lower than in 2019, Gregg said. “Because of the continued decline in the USF revenue base, the average assessment factor for all of 2020 will be 23.37%, the highest average annual assessment factor ever.”
